Market Overview

This market encompasses solvents derived from renewable feedstocks—such as agricultural crops, biomass, and waste materials—that are characterized by low toxicity, high biodegradability, and minimal volatile organic compound (VOC) emissions. The transition from traditional petrochemical solvents is accelerating due to stringent environmental regulations, corporate sustainability mandates, and growing consumer preference for eco-friendly products across industrial and consumer sectors.
Market Segmentation
By Type:
-
Bio-Alcohols (Bio-Ethanol, Bio-Methanol, Bio-Butanol)
-
Bio-Glycols & Diols (Bio-based Propylene Glycol, 1,3-Propanediol, Ethylene Glycol)
-
Lactate Esters (Ethyl Lactate, Methyl Lactate)
-
Bio-D-Limonene (Derived from citrus peels)
-
Vegetable Oil Derivatives (Methyl Soyate, Epoxidized Soybean Oil)
-
Bio-based Hydrocarbons (p-Cymene, Terpenes)
-
Bio-based Aromatics (Furfural derivatives)
-
Others (Glycerol Carbonate, 2-Methyltetrahydrofuran)
By Application:
-
Paints, Coatings & Inks (Largest application segment; used as coalescing agents, diluents, and cleaners)
-
Industrial & Domestic Cleaners (Degreasers, detergents, and surface cleaners)
-
Adhesives & Sealants
-
Pharmaceuticals & Cosmetics (Extraction solvents, carriers, and formulation aids)
-
Agriculture (Solvents in pesticide and herbicide formulations)
-
Electronics (Precision cleaning agents)
-
Polymer & Plastic Processing
By Source:
-
Starch & Sugar Crops (Corn, sugarcane, wheat)
-
Vegetable Oils (Soybean, palm, rapeseed)
-
Forestry & Agricultural Residues (Lignocellulosic biomass)
-
Citrus & Other Bio-Waste
Regional Analysis
-
North America: A mature and regulatory-driven market, led by the U.S. EPA's VOC regulations and strong corporate ESG (Environmental, Social, and Governance) commitments. Significant R&D investments and presence of key agricultural feedstock producers.
-
Europe: The global leader in adoption, propelled by the stringent EU REACH, VOC Directive, and Circular Economy Action Plan. High consumer awareness and a robust regulatory push for bio-based products.
-
Asia-Pacific: The fastest-growing region, driven by rapid industrialization, tightening environmental policies in China and India, and abundant availability of low-cost biomass feedstocks. Growing manufacturing base for paints, adhesives, and cleaners.
-
South America: Substantial market potential due to large-scale agricultural production (sugarcane, soy) providing key feedstocks, particularly in Brazil and Argentina.
-
Middle East & Africa: Nascent market with growth opportunities tied to diversification from petrochemicals and development of sustainable industrial practices.

Porter’s Five Forces Analysis
-
Threat of New Entrants: Moderate to High. Entry is encouraged by favorable regulations and growing demand, but requires significant capital for bio-refineries, strong R&D in biotechnology, and established feedstock supply chains.
-
Bargaining Power of Suppliers: Moderate. Suppliers of agricultural feedstocks (farmers, co-ops) have influence, but large buyers can source from multiple regions. Prices are subject to agricultural commodity volatility.
-
Bargaining Power of Buyers: High. Large industrial buyers in coatings and cleaning sectors demand cost-competitive, drop-in replacements with guaranteed performance, leading to price sensitivity and demand for technical support.
-
Threat of Substitutes: Moderate. Competition exists from advanced petrochemical solvents with improved environmental profiles, water-based systems, and solvent-free technologies. However, the unique performance and regulatory compliance of bio-solvents provide strong defense.
-
Industry Rivalry: High. Competition is intensifying on price, performance, sustainability certification, and the ability to offer a broad portfolio of drop-in and novel solutions.
SWOT Analysis
-
Strengths: Renewable origin, reduced carbon footprint, low toxicity, compliance with stringent regulations, positive consumer perception.
-
Weaknesses: Generally higher cost than conventional solvents, performance variations, competition with food sources for feedstocks (first-generation), and complex, energy-intensive production processes for some types.
-
Opportunities: Strong regulatory tailwinds globally; corporate net-zero carbon pledges; advancement in 2nd and 3rd generation feedstocks (non-food biomass, waste); innovation in solvent performance for niche, high-value applications.
-
Threats: Volatility in agricultural commodity prices; "greenwashing" accusations affecting credibility; economic downturns pushing cost-cutting over sustainability; slow regulatory adoption in some developing regions.
Trend Analysis
-
Beyond First-Generation: Accelerated R&D and commercialization of solvents derived from lignocellulosic biomass (agricultural residues, forestry waste) and microbial fermentation to avoid food-versus-fuel debates.
-
Performance-Driven Innovation: Development of bio-solvents that match or exceed the performance of their petrochemical counterparts in terms of solvency, evaporation rate, and formulation stability.
-
Circular Economy Integration: Designing solvents from industrial and municipal bio-waste streams, closing the loop and creating value from waste.
-
Digitalization & AI: Use of artificial intelligence and computational chemistry to design and screen new bio-solvent molecules with optimal properties for specific applications.

Value Chain Analysis
-
Feedstock Cultivation & Sourcing: Sustainable agriculture for crops or collection of biomass/waste streams.
-
Bio-Conversion & Processing: Fermentation, chemical catalysis, or extraction in bio-refineries to convert biomass into platform chemicals and final solvent products.
-
Purification & Formulation: Distillation and chemical processing to achieve required purity and functional properties. May involve blending for specific applications.
-
Distribution & Certification: Supply through chemical distributors, often accompanied by third-party sustainability certifications (e.g., USDA Certified Biobased, ISCC PLUS).
-
End-Use Integration: Adoption by formulators in paints, cleaners, adhesives, etc., who must reformulate or adapt processes to integrate the new solvents effectively.
